1. Understand the Sources of Football News

To interpret football news accurately, begin by understanding the sources of information. Not all news outlets provide the same level of reliability. Established sports journalism platforms and well-known reporters usually adhere to strict journalistic standards and fact-checking. For instance, papers like The Guardian, BBC Sport, or sports-focused sites like ESPN are generally more reliable than lesser-known blogs or social media accounts, which may propagate misinformation. Check the credibility by looking for consistent reporting patterns and cross-referencing stories, particularly those of high significance, such as transfer news or controversies involving clubs.

2. Familiarise Yourself with Football Terminology

A solid grasp of football terminology is crucial when delving into news articles. Understanding terms such as "offside," "set pieces," and "pressing" can help you follow discussions and analyses more closely. Various phrases have specific meanings that can greatly influence the interpretation of a match report or a tactical breakdown. For instance, if an article discusses a team's 'high press,' knowing that this signifies a strategy to exert pressure on the opposition immediately after losing possession will give you a deeper understanding of the narrative being presented. Take time to study commonly utilised terminologies; resources such as football glossaries or tutorials can be quite helpful as you build your knowledge.

3. Analyze Data and Statistics

In 2026, data analytics plays a pivotal role in football reporting. Articles often contain a wealth of statistics like player pass accuracy, expected goals (xG), and successful dribbles, which provide crucial insights into performances. Rather than relying solely on qualitative descriptions, integrate quantitative analyses into your assessments of match reports. For example, if a report states that a player had an exceptional game, cross-reference with their data—did they achieve high pass completion? Compare percentages against league averages or your team's performance at various points of the season. This comprehensive approach towards data enables you to garner a more nuanced interpretation of the news.

4. Consider the Context of the News

Understanding the context surrounding football news is essential for accurate interpretation. Context can include league standings, historical rivalries, player injuries, or even socio-political implications of certain events within the sport. Take, for instance, the significance of a major derby: the emotional stakes can heighten the impact of the news. A loss in a derby may not just reflect poor performance—it speaks volumes in terms of fan expectations, morale, and even the trajectory of a season. Always consider the broader landscape when processing the information you consume, as this is often the critical component in truly understanding football narratives.

5. Spot Bias and Agenda-Setting in Reporting

It is crucial to identify bias within news articles. Different media outlets often have affiliations with clubs or players, leading to a slanted portrayal of events. For instance, a newspaper that has a history of close ties with a particular club may downplay negative news concerning that club while amplifying critical narratives about rivals. This could manifest in selective reporting—focusing on certain statistics while ignoring others. Actively seek out diverse viewpoints to counteract inherent biases; your understanding of the story will be richer and more nuanced. Regularly consuming a wide variety of coverage will also enhance your ability to spot biases more effectively.

6. Engage with Community Analysis

Engaging with community analysis and discussions can significantly bolster your understanding of football news. Online forums, fan sites, and social media groups are treasure troves of insights where fans dissect match reports, tactical decisions, and player's performances. Whether it's a Reddit discussion thread or a blog on in-depth analysis, these platforms often present alternative perspectives that complement professional journalism. For instance, contributions from fans often highlight details overlooked by mainstream media. Engaging in such communities allows for dynamic discussions and can deepen understanding further.

7. Keep a Football News Journal

Maintaining a football news journal can be a valuable tool for serious fans and analysts. Documenting key insights gleaned from articles can help you not just retain information better, but also track developments over time. By summarising articles or jotting down your own analyses of matches, you cultivate a personalised view of the sport. Over time, revisiting these notes can reveal patterns, such as recurring team strategies or player performance trends, making it easier to anticipate future developments.

Glossary

TermDefinition
Expected Goals (xG)A statistic that estimates the probability of a goal being scored from a shot, based on various factors like distance and angle.
Offside RuleA rule in football designed to prevent players from gaining an unfair advantage by being in front of the last defender when the ball is played to them.
PressingA strategy where players actively attempt to win back possession of the ball when they lose it.
